WebWhat are social-religious reform movements? These social and religious reform movements arose among all communities of the Indian people. They attacked bigotry, superstition and the hold of the priestly class. They worked for the abolition of castes and untouchability, the purdah system, sati, child marriage, social inequalities and illiteracy. WebIndia has a long history of social reform movements. Aurobindo Ghosh an Indian philosopher quoted that “it was in religion first that the soul of India woke and triumphed.”. The 19th century saw a series of religious and social reform movements.
